How they compare
Bulgaria currently reports 0.4% against 0.0% in Kazakhstan, a difference of 0.4%.
That makes Bulgaria's figure about 84.8 times Kazakhstan's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Kazakhstan ahead.
Bulgaria ranks 103rd and Kazakhstan ranks 106th of 107 countries.
Kazakhstan has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
